Python for Beginners courses can help you learn basic programming concepts, data types, control structures, and functions. You can build skills in writing clean code, debugging, and using libraries like NumPy and pandas for data manipulation. Many courses also cover practical applications such as web scraping, data visualization, and automating tasks, providing hands-on experience with tools like Jupyter Notebook and Git.

Skills you'll gain: Vue.JS, UI Components, User Interface (UI), User Interface (UI) Design, User Interface and User Experience (UI/UX) Design, JavaScript Frameworks, Role-Based Access Control (RBAC), Front-End Web Development, Authentications, Web Applications, Web Components, Authorization (Computing), Web Development Tools, Real Time Data, Responsive Web Design, Development Environment, Data Management
Beginner · Course · 1 - 3 Months

Skills you'll gain: Generative AI, ChatGPT
Beginner · Course · 1 - 4 Weeks

Berklee
Skills you'll gain: Music, Active Listening, Musical Composition, Meditation & Breathwork, Self-Awareness, Stress Management, World Music, Personal Care, Mental Health, Mental Concentration, Emotional Intelligence, Resilience
Beginner · Course · 1 - 4 Weeks

Alex Genadinik
Skills you'll gain: Blockchain, Digital Assets, Emerging Technologies, FinTech, Payment Systems, Ledgers (Accounting), Data Security
Mixed · Course · 1 - 3 Months

University of California, Davis
Skills you'll gain: Peer Review, Language Learning, Spanish Language, Language Competency, Oral Expression, Grammar, Oral Comprehension, Culture, Writing and Editing, Vocabulary, Research
Beginner · Specialization · 3 - 6 Months

Skills you'll gain: Salesforce, Administration, Role-Based Access Control (RBAC), Data Sharing, User Provisioning, Systems Administration, Security Controls, Data Access, User Accounts, System Configuration, Workflow Management, Data Validation, Identity and Access Management, Information Architecture, Calendar Management, Data Integrity, Data Quality, Customer Relationship Management (CRM) Software
Beginner · Course · 1 - 3 Months

Skills you'll gain: Adobe Illustrator, Logo Design, Graphic Design, Creative Design, Graphics Software, Adobe Creative Cloud, Graphic and Visual Design, Style Guides, Project Design, Digital Design, Design Software, Typography, Layout Design, File Management, Design Elements And Principles, Design Specifications, Color Theory
Beginner · Guided Project · Less Than 2 Hours

Duke University
Skills you'll gain: Pandas (Python Package), Version Control, Git (Version Control System), Data Manipulation, Software Development Tools, Development Environment, Data Structures, Python Programming, Microsoft Development Tools, Data Analysis Software, Package and Software Management, Virtual Environment
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Model Evaluation, Model Training, Classification And Regression Tree (CART), Decision Tree Learning, Data Preprocessing, R (Software), Statistical Modeling, R Programming, Supervised Learning, Machine Learning
Beginner · Guided Project · Less Than 2 Hours
Duke University
Skills you'll gain: Responsible AI, AI powered creativity, Data Ethics, Adobe Firefly, Productivity Software, AI Workflows, Generative AI, Productivity, AI Integrations, Writing, AI literacy, Writing and Editing, Gemini, Microsoft Copilot, Unstructured Data, Prompt Engineering, Administrative Support, Data Analysis, Operational Efficiency, Media Production
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Milestones (Project Management), Project Management Software, Delegation Skills, Project Planning, Project Coordination, Databases, Relational Databases, Project Management, Collaborative Software, Team Oriented
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: Google Ads, Keyword Research, Advertising Campaigns, Online Advertising, Campaign Management, Digital Advertising, Search Engine Marketing, Marketing
Beginner · Guided Project · Less Than 2 Hours